What Are the Safest Dividend Stocks for Your Portfolio?

TL;DR

The safest dividend stocks include Prudential Financial with a 4.8% yield and 15 years of dividend growth, KeyCorp at 4.3% with strong commercial banking growth, Main Street Capital yielding 6.8% and increasing dividends for 10 years, and Eastman Chemical at 3.5% with a solid financial structure. The S&P Dividend Aristocrats ETF also offers a diversified portfolio of companies with over 25 years of consistent dividend increases.

Questions & Answers

Q: What makes Prudential Financial a safe dividend stock?

Prudential Financial has predictable cash flows, international diversification, and a lower payout ratio compared to competitors. These factors contribute to its dividend sustainability.

Q: Why is KeyCorp considered a safe dividend stock?

KeyCorp has a strong growth in its commercial banking segment, a lower payout ratio, and a consistent track record of higher dividend payments. These factors indicate its safety as a dividend stock.

Q: What sets Main Street Capital apart as a safe dividend stock?

Main Street Capital specializes in loans to mid-sized businesses and has a strong track record of paying increasing dividends for 10 straight years. Its diversified portfolio of investments and a monthly payer make it a safe choice.

Q: How does Eastman Chemical maintain its safety as a dividend stock?

Eastman Chemical has been selling off non-core segments, focusing on Specialty Chemicals, and has a lower payout ratio than its peers. Its strong share repurchase program and cost reduction plan contribute to its safety as a dividend stock.

Summary & Key Takeaways

  • Prudential Financial (PRU) has a 4.8% dividend yield and 15 years of increasing payments. With predictable cash flows and international diversification, it is considered a safe dividend stock.

  • KeyCorp (KEY) is a smaller regional bank with a 4.3% dividend and 12 consecutive years of higher payments. Strong growth in its commercial banking segment and a lower payout ratio make it a safe choice.

  • Main Street Capital (MAIN) is a Business Development Corporation specializing in loans to mid-sized businesses. It pays a 6.8% dividend yield and has been increasing its payment for 10 straight years.

  • Eastman Chemical (EMN) has a rock-solid 3.5% dividend and 13 years of increasing payments. While more cyclical, it has a lower payout ratio and has been paying down its debt consistently.
